NY POST CRITIC PRAISES 3D OZ

New York Post film critic Lou Lumenick boasted on Sunday that he was able to get a “first look” of the 3D IMAX version of The Wizard of Oz and assured readers who had expressed concerns about Warner Bros.’ fiddling with the classic that they can relax. “For me, the stereoscopic Oz moderately enhances the enjoyment of a film that was already about as entertaining as they come,” he wrote. “It looks fantastic, sounds great, and the 3D effects (reportedly labored over for 16 months by a thousand technicians) are both subtle and respectfully applied.” The film is scheduled to open for a one-week run beginning on Friday. A 3D Blu-ray release is due to hit retail outlets on Oct. 1. For purists, Lumenick observes, that release even includes the 2D version of the movie.
